Ukraine has understanding of how to ensure supplies to combat zones, hold rear - Shmyhal

Ukraine has entered 2023 with a clear understanding of how best to counter the enemy, how to secure the front and hold the rear.

Ukrainian Prime Minister Denys Shmyhal said this at a government meeting on Tuesday, an Ukrinform correspondent reports.

"We’re entering this year with a clear understanding of how to counter the enemy, how to secure supplies to the front, and hold the rear. We must remain united and continue to act as one," Shmyhal said.

The prime minister announced a number of government priorities and main directions in which the country will move in 2023. The key ones were named by President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ky in his annual message. First of all, the Prime Minister noted, the government must focus on supplying the Army with all that is needed.

As Ukrinform reported, Shmyhal previously noted that the government allocated more than  UAH 1.2 trillion to the security and defense sector amid the full-scale war unleashed by Russia.
